Output d26cb17296b79345658a7cd77ae17ec551e076ad6ca21a2bedb8a2b5dd0f759f:13

value
139700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f81d0392a920ad2fe407c318bec29b67b903526 OP_EQUAL
address
3DKDFVofgdS8B5hxwrp2QXbSogd3p1RLPp
transaction
d26cb17296b79345658a7cd77ae17ec551e076ad6ca21a2bedb8a2b5dd0f759f
confirmations
345942
spent
true